National Gallery Global Ltd (NGG) is seeking an experienced Hospitality & Events Manager to enhance event operations at their prestigious venue. This full-time role, based in the heart of London, involves managing corporate events, venue hire, and filming projects, ensuring high standards.

Key attributes required include:

  • Strong sales experience
  • Excellent communication skills
  • The ability to network with clients

This position includes flexible hours with some evening and weekend work.
